90-Degree Heat, From Washington State To Washington D.C. A band of 90-plus degree heat is forecast again today across a wide area of the United States, even as cooler temperatures bring relief to parts of the northern plains, Great Lakes, Appalachians and Northeast. The heat band stretches from the Pacific Northwest -- where excessive heat warnings are in place and 100-plus degree heat is forecast through much of Washington state -- through the Rockies and the Southwest, across the South and up the East coast as far as the capital region. Temperature will top out above 100 degrees in Southern California and Nevada, across much of Arizona and parts of Texas. Parts of Georgia and South Carolina have warned residents to take care because of intense heat there. The heat wave, like the wildfires, drought and floods gripping the nation this summer may not be signs that global warming's effects are near and present. But at the least, they are signs of things to come if runaway climate change isn't curtailed.
